Mehdi Hashemi (1946 – 28 September 1987) was an Shi’a cleric who was defrocked by the Special Clerical Court. After the 1979 Revolution, he became a senior official in the Islamic Revolutionary Guards; he was executed by the Islamic Republic in its first decade.
